How much does it cost to rent a home in Aspendale?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Aspendale 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,344 | $1,850 | $2,900 |
| Aspendale 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,611 | $1,998 | $3,500 |
| Aspendale 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,266 | $2,230 | $7,500 |
| Aspendale 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,500 | $3,000 | $8,500 |
| Aspendale 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,300 | $4,300 | $4,300 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Aspendale
What type of rentals are currently available in Aspendale?
There are currently 70 Apartments for Rent in Aspendale, TX with pricing that ranges from $908 to $17,327. There are also 284 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Aspendale ranging from $1,850 to $8,500.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Aspendale?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Aspendale ranges from $1,850 to $8,500 with an average monthly rent of $3,404.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Aspendale?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Aspendale range from $1,444 to $4,573,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,998 to $3,500.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,230 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,624.
